    C808M-G (4/05) 3 Description The VS5004 and VS5008 sequential switchers are designed to switch up to four (VS5004) or eight (VS5008) cameras manually or automatically to one or two monitors with automatic response to alarm inputs. Both versions are Coaxitron ® compatible and can be placed on a desktop or rack mounted. MODELS VS5004 Sequential swit ...

    10 C808M-G (4/05) 4. Set the ALARM switch to the ON position. NOTES: • With all channel switches set to the AUTO position, both monitors immediately switch to the alarmed channel and the associated LED blinks. Multiple alarmed channels sequence every five seconds (VS5004) or three seconds (VS5008). The alarm has priority over the MONITOR/AUTO/BY ...
